The weight of the givensolid cylinder rodis 2512 N.
The density of the body is `"________"` Kg `m_(-3)`.
`(take g =10 m s_(-2))`

A

2512

B

`25 xx 12`

C

`10^3`

D

`10^6`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

Volume `=pi xx ("radius")^2 xx "height"`
`=pi xx (0.02)^2 xx 0.2=25.12 xx 10^(-5) m^(3)`
Weight `=m xx g`
`"Mass "=("weight")/g=(2512)/(10)=251.2kg`
`"Density "=("mass")/("volume")=(251.2)/(25.12 xx 10^(-5))=(25.12 xx 10^1)/(25.12 xx 10^(-5))`
`=106"kg m"^(-3)`
